第3章处理机调度与死锁..ppt

【教学目的】了解处理机调度的基本概念、调度算法和类型及死锁的概念、产生条件及检测与解除。 【教学重点】1、处理机调度原理及算法。2、死锁的产生原因及检测与解除。 【分配课时】进度计划6学时 第三章 处理机调度与死锁 3.1 处理机调度的基本概念 3.2 进程调度算法 3.3 实时调度 3.4 多处理机系统中的调度 3.5 产生死锁的原因和必要条件 3.6 预防死锁的方法和死锁避免 3.7 死锁的检测和解除 第一节????调度的类型和模型 一、 调度类型 1、高级调度(High?? level Scheduling)(或作业//长程//接纳调度) (1)定义 ???? 把外存上处于后备队列中的那些作业调入内存,并为它们创建进程、分配必要的资源,然后,再将新创建的进程排在就绪队列上,准备执行。 在批处理系统中,是先驻留在外存上的,因此需要有作业调度,以将它们分批装入内存。在分时系统中,为了能及时响应,用户通过键盘输入的命令或数据等,都是直接送入内存,因而无需配置作业调度。 (2)决定作业调度的两个因素 ①接纳多少个作业 ???? 作业调度每次要接纳多少个作业进入内存,取决于多道程序度(Degree of Multiprogramming),即允许有多少个作业同时在内存中运行。 ②接纳哪些作业 ???? 应将哪些作业从外存调入内存,将取决于所采用的调度算法。最简单的是先来先服务调

文档评论(0)

1亿VIP精品文档

相关文档